I'm just doing a project at work using a laser displacement sensor from DSE
(Danish Sensor Engineering, i think) It measures from 100mm to 300mm with
0.01mm resolution. It measures with a frequency of 2000Hz and spitts out the
data at 115kbaud. It also has various internal average-routines and 'false
reading skipping'. Very easy to use windows .dll to use in your own
software, which I do (VB).
I have this dream, when the project is over, to borrow the sensor, put it on
my machine and use Mach2 to play a bit with 3D scanning.
The downside is the price of the sensor. 40.000SEK, about $5.000.
